Hey all and hoping for some expert advise....
I am about to install a Redarc 1225d bcdc in my trailer along with a Battleborn life4po battery, midi fuses, Redarc low voltage disconnect, etc. I will also be running dedicated charge wires from the Land Cruiser to the Redarc in the trailer. Wiring those pieces makes sense to me but i have a question about the existing 7pin trailer wiring coming from the Land Cruiser to the trailer. The 7 pin connector supplies 12v to the old battery....Do I need to or should i disconnect that ? If i do should i leave the ground coming from the truck from the 7 pin connector attached? Maybe i am overthinking things here.... My thought was to remove the 12v coming from the truck but leave the ground.

I suggest leave it live from the car, but just dont connect anything to it inside your trailer. You will need to leave your negative ground intact as it provides negative for your brakes, taillamps, etc.
